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 9fb80b59 authored by Josh Tsuji's avatar Josh Tsuji Committed by Automerger Merge Worker
Browse files

Merge "Play sounds only once, on keyguard exit." into sc-dev am: f0221c00

Original change: https://googleplex-android-review.googlesource.com/c/platform/frameworks/base/+/15131654

Change-Id: Ic8910e0f576d106afb3c04a161fc3f82035583ae
parents a55728eb f0221c00
Loading
Loading
Loading
Loading
+7 −6
Original line number Diff line number Diff line
@@ -2178,12 +2178,6 @@ public class KeyguardViewMediator extends SystemUI implements Dumpable,
                mDrawnCallback = null;
            }

            // only play "unlock" noises if not on a call (since the incall UI
            // disables the keyguard)
            if (TelephonyManager.EXTRA_STATE_IDLE.equals(mPhoneState)) {
                playSounds(false);
            }

            LatencyTracker.getInstance(mContext)
                    .onActionEnd(LatencyTracker.ACTION_LOCKSCREEN_UNLOCK);

@@ -2301,6 +2295,13 @@ public class KeyguardViewMediator extends SystemUI implements Dumpable,
    }

    private void onKeyguardExitFinished() {
        // only play "unlock" noises if not on a call (since the incall UI
        // disables the keyguard)
        if (TelephonyManager.EXTRA_STATE_IDLE.equals(mPhoneState)) {
            Log.i("TEST", "playSounds: false");
            playSounds(false);
        }

        setShowingLocked(false);
        mWakeAndUnlocking = false;
        mDismissCallbackRegistry.notifyDismissSucceeded();